Business Visit Visa
Highly EligibleVisa for meetings, negotiations, and short commercial engagements with Saudi entities. Does not permit hands-on employment.
- Processing time
- A few days to 2 weeks
- Validity
- Typically 90 days single entry or up to 1 year multiple entry, with stays commonly capped at 90 days per visit
- Government fees
- Approx. SAR 300-500 plus service fees, varying by nationality and duration
Requirements
- Invitation from a Saudi company (attested via the Chamber of Commerce/MOFA platform)
- Employer letter confirming role and purpose of travel
- Passport valid at least 6 months
- Proof of professional status
Documents you will need
- Valid passport: 6+ months validity
- Saudi invitation letter: MOFA-attested invitation from the host entity
- Employer letter: Confirming employment and travel purpose
- Passport photos: Per Saudi specifications
Worth knowing
- Productive work on a visit visa is illegal and enforcement is real - use it only for meetings and negotiations
- Multiple-entry business visas suit ongoing commercial relationships
- eVisa-eligible passport holders can handle light meetings on a tourist eVisa, but the invitation-based business visa is the safe choice for anything substantive
Restrictions
- No employment or hands-on project work permitted
- Overstays incur fines and future entry bans
